Bioactivity | MOR-CES2 is a near-infrared fluorescent probe capable of identifying cancer cells and tissues, as well as exhibiting a sensitive response to inflammation. MOR-CES2 holds potential as an efficient imaging tool in assisting surgical resection of CES2-related tumors[1]. |
